She is sweet very light. Scandium and Ti alloy. The best part she is an 8 shooter. Plenty of 357 power. Best double action trigger I have ever pulled same in single action. It comes for S&W performance shop. Looking for a good carry holster now.

Nice !! If you're looking for a full-on custom, or a good hand made rig... look up Sam Andrews Leather. I really like his shoulder holster rigs. They're not attached at the belt (restricting side to side movement). They interconnect (holster on one side, mag pouches on the other side) via a side to side back strap which crosses your back fairly low. Does a good job of keeping the gun in place, whether leaning forward, or side to side. It also keeps the holster in place as you unsnap/draw (forward) the gun.
